What are the typical challenges faced by professionals in celebrity protection, and how are they addressed?

Professionals in celebrity protection often encounter challenges such as managing unpredictable public interactions, maintaining privacy for high-profile clients, and adapting to rapidly changing schedules or locations. These challenges are addressed by thorough advance planning, ongoing risk assessments, and close coordination with event organizers, law enforcement, and the client’s personal staff. Strong communication skills and the ability to remain calm under pressure are essential, as is the use of technology and surveillance techniques to proactively identify and mitigate potential threats.

How do celebrities get bodyguards?

Celebrity protection professionals are typically hired through specialized security agencies that have experience working with high-profile clients. Celebrities often work with agents or managers to identify reputable security firms, and bodyguards usually have training in security protocols, first aid, and sometimes law enforcement or military backgrounds. The process involves vetting security personnel, assessing the celebrity's risk level, and establishing a tailored security plan.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Celebrity Protection Spec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Celebrity Protection Specialist, you need a background in security operations, risk assessment, and emergency response, often supported by law enforcement or military experience and relevant security certifications. Familiarity with surveillance technology, secure transportation systems, and communication tools is typically required. Exceptional situational awareness, discretion, and strong interpersonal skills help build trust with clients and navigate high-pressure environments. These abilities are crucial for ensuring the safety, privacy, and peace of mind of high-profile individuals in unpredictable situations.

Celebrity Protection and Bodyguard roles share many similarities, including required certifications and work environments. However, Celebrity Protection often involves managing the safety of high-profile individuals during public appearances and events, focusing on reputation management. Bodyguards typically provide personal security for a broader range of clients, including private individuals and corporate executives. Both roles demand similar skills and training but differ slightly in scope and context.

How to get a job as a celebrity bodyguard?

To become a celebrity bodyguard, individuals typically need security or law enforcement experience, strong physical fitness, and training in protective tactics. Obtaining certifications such as first aid and firearms training can enhance prospects, and networking within the entertainment industry can help secure opportunities.

What is celebrity protection?

Celebrity protection refers to the specialized security services provided to high-profile individuals, such as actors, musicians, athletes, and public figures, to ensure their safety and privacy. Professionals in celebrity protection assess potential risks, plan secure travel routes, and accompany clients during public appearances and private activities. Their role often includes crowd control, threat assessment, and close coordination with law enforcement to prevent incidents. A strong emphasis is placed on discretion and confidentiality to allow celebrities to lead their lives with minimal disruption.

Job description

POSITION SUMMARY

Provide personalized and detailed guest service assistance to VIP guests throughout their stay offering smooth registration and departure procedures. Review and log guest preferences/traces in computer systems. Respond to requests for visitor information, special arrangements, activities or services by making arrangements or identifying appropriate providers. Respond to special requests from VIP guests with unique needs and follow up to promote satisfaction. Gather, summarize and provide information about the property and the surrounding area amenities, including special events and activities. Contact appropriate individuals or departments as necessary to resolve calls, requests or problems. Understand and assist with reservation services. Post charges (e.g., telephone calls, tickets, valet parking, etc.) to guest accounts. Collect payment for services rendered. Inspect VIP guest's rooms and deliver gifts and requested items prior to guest arrival. Review and update logs and document in appropriate computer systems.

Follow all company policies and procedures; report accidents, injuries, and unsafe work conditions to manager; verify uniform and personal appearance are clean and professional; maintain confidentiality of proprietary information; protect company assets. Welcome and acknowledge all guests according to company standards; anticipate and address guests' service needs; thank guests with genuine appreciation. Speak with others using clear and professional language; answer telephones using appropriate etiquette. Develop and maintain positive working relationships with others; support team to reach common goals. Comply with quality assurance expectations and standards. Identify and recommend new ideas, technologies, or processes to increase organizational efficiency, productivity, quality, safety, and/or cost-savings. Stand, sit, or walk for an extended period of time or for an entire work shift. Move, lift, carry, push, pull, and place objects weighing less than or equal to 25 pounds without assistance. Perform other reasonable job duties as requested.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

Education: High school diploma or G.E.D. equivalent.

Supervisory Experience: No supervisory experience.

License or Certification: None

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

Related Work Experience: 6 months guest service work experience required.
